Title: rattling noise when accelerating
Post by: Adamdubz on 11 January 2011, 21:08
Sounds like its coming from in front of me when driving got oil and everything in the car a mechanic said it could be the hydraulics on top of the cam but I don’t know to much about engines so could use some help   
Title: Re: rattling noise when accelerating
Post by: Sam on 11 January 2011, 21:14
Could be a number of things but if a mech has had a look at it and thinks its the tappets.... then it probbaly is. For a start you could go out and buy yourself some hydraulic tappet cleaner that you add to the oil. Not amaizingly effective but can sort out small blocks. Other than that its cams off and tappets out my friend  :smiley:
